We have enjoyed dinner here yhree times; once during the winter and twice during tourist season. It is always a good idea to call ahead for a table during peak dinner hours as they often have most tables filled, but for the two of us they have always been able to accommodate us even with as little as 15 minutes calling ahead. Larger parties probably will need to book ahead.
We have tried several types of pizza, pastas, a vegetarian calzone, the simple salad, appetizers and desserts. Every dish has been expertly crafted blending of flavors to take simple ingredients, such as the lemon garlic spaghetti, and serve a wonderfully satisfying dish. The crust for the pizzas and the canzone is fluffy with th9s satusying air pockets and perfectly crisper for a nice crunch in the bite. They dress the salad lightly and use very fresh produce, so the flavors marry and complement each other. The desserts are worth saving room to enjoy, though we usually share one between us two. The cheesecake with it swirled chocolate and vanilla in both the filling and the crust was a delight, and the pannecotta is perfection-- on ours the chef used the island red berries topping to give it an Açorean touch, which is a bit more tart than other berries, but an interesting twist and made it a more refreshing summer dessert and not overly sweet.
The staff knows how to do their respective jobs and do them with quiet, friendly excellence. We always feel welcomed and well tended to, and servers who read the table to match the level of interaction with the customer; I have experienced and observed that they are happy to chat a bit as they serve, or simply take orders and serve with a crisp, professional style that is always given with an authentic smile.
